E45 Itch Relief Cream contains an anti-itch ingredient, lauromacrogols, which acts as a topical anaesthetic to soothe the itching caused by eczema, dermatitis, pruritus, and scaling skin conditions. It also contains urea, a moisturiser found naturally within the skin, which helps the skin retain moisture and has a soothing effect. The cream is perfume-free and dermatologically tested, making it suitable for the whole family, including infants over the age of one month.

Directions

How to use:

  • Apply to the affected skin 2 times daily.
  • Ensure the skin is clean and dry before application.

Frequency:

  • Use as needed to relieve itching and maintain skin hydration.

Aftercare:

  • Store below 25°C.
  • Keep out of the sight and reach of children.

Ingredients

Active ingredients per 100g:

  • Urea: 5.0g
  • Lauromacrogols: 3.0g

Other ingredients:

  • Dimeticone
  • Phenyl Dimeticone
  • Liquid Paraffin
  • Cetyl Palmitate
  • Stearic Palmitic Acid
  • Octyldodecanol
  • Glycerol
  • Polysorbate
  • Carbomer
  • Trometamol
  • Benzyl Alcohol
  • Purified Water

Side Effects

Possible Side Effects:

  • Occasionally, allergic reactions or worsening of acne may occur.
  • If you suspect an allergic reaction, such as a rash, or if anything unusual happens, stop using the product.
  • If you get any side effects, talk to your doctor, pharmacist, or nurse.

Please note that fabric (clothing, bedding, dressings, etc.) that has been in contact with this product burns more easily and is a serious fire hazard. Washing clothing and bedding may reduce product build-up but not totally remove it.
